Before I slowly begin the process of really upgrading the schemes I have by modifying schemes out there already (which as I'm sure everyone knows can be very tedious when it comes to removing camo and markings), I thought I'd ask if there were any blank templates (devoid of camo schemes and markings) out there or are in the works. Of course, my main interest is for British aircraft, but others would be welcome as well. Simply using such templates as a Multiply or Screen layer in PhotoShop and just removing the old "base" would make conversions quite simple.
